Definition
  1. Adjective:
    • Extremely foul-smelling; stinking badly: Describes a very strong, offensive, and unpleasant odor. It is an emphatic form of "hôi" (smelly), indicating a higher degree of repulsiveness.
Usage Examples
  • Adjective:
    • Cái thùng rác này hôi ình. (This trash can stinks terribly.)
    • Phòng tắm công cộng đôi khi hôi ình. (Public bathrooms sometimes smell awful.)
    • Sau khi chơi thể thao, áo của anh ấy hôi ình. (After playing sports, his shirt reeks.)
Advanced Usage
  • The term "hôi ình" is often used in informal, colloquial speech for dramatic effect. It is not typically used in formal writing.
Variants and Related Words
  • Hôi (adj): smelly, malodorous. A less intense synonym.

    • Thức ăn này đã hôi. (This food has gone bad/smelly.)
  • Thối (adj): rotten, putrid. Often describes the smell of decay.

    • Mùi thối của rác. (The rotten smell of garbage.)
